On The premise of their cannabinoid profiles, five chemotypes are actually recognised: chemotype I comprises drug type plants having a predominance of Δ9-THC-sort cannabinoids; chemotypes III and IV are fibre-style plants containing large levels of nonpsychoactive cannabinoids and very minimal amounts of psychoactive types; chemotype II comprises plants with intermediate features concerning drug-sort and fibre-variety plants; chemotype V is made up of fibre-type plants which incorporates Pretty much no cannabinoids [5].
